The Philippines gets its first Mobile browser banking service

A big mobile browser banking service has been launched in the Philippines. The service was created by a joint venture between SK Telecom and Citibank Philippines - Mobile Money Ventures (MMV). MMV claims the service is the first of its kind in the area. It will allow Citibank customers to view account info, pay bills and transfer money and allows Citibank clients to access their account information. And since it’s browser-based, it will work on pretty much any phone.
